One issue:

+* The `gtk+3.0 tests`_ do two things: firstly they run the upstream 
+ test-suite as part of ``autopkgtest``. Secondly they execute a python
+ program using ``xvfb`` to emulate a running X session.

That's not quite true, the upstream tests are currently only run during package 
build. Somethign like this:

 * The `gtk+3.0 tests`_ also do a compile/link/run check in the "build" test. 
There is an additional "python3-gi" test which verifies that the GTK library 
can also be used through introspection.
